The Roots of Patriotism and Hatred

Why does the term patriots hatred surface so often? Because defending a nation sometimes means attacking its perceived enemies. That line blurs fast. People forget that true pride requires defending values, not just borders.

When Pride Turns to Poison

Loyalty becomes toxic fast. A fan cheering for a hometown team crosses a line when they start insulting rival supporters. National pride follows the same path.

- Symbolic aggression: Burning flags or mocking monuments often stems from perceived betrayal. - Us-versus-them mentality: Group identity requires an outsider. Hatred fills that role. - Historical grievance: Past wars and losses fuel generational anger.

These emotions twist love into something sharp. The patriots hatred label usually appears when someone weaponizes their pride against vulnerable groups.

The Psychology of In-Group Hostility

Psychologists call this out-group homogeneity. We assume everyone outside our circle thinks and acts alike. The threat feels real. The hatred feels justified.

A citizen might despise a neighbor not for personal faults, but for assumed political apathy. This internal conflict hurts communities. Strong bonds inside a group often require a strong wall against outsiders.

Real patriotism asks difficult questions. It requires empathy for fellow citizens, even those with different views. Patriots hatred destroys that empathy. It replaces curiosity with contempt.

Case Studies of Weaponized Nationalism

History offers plenty of examples where patriotism curdled into bigotry. Authoritarian regimes frequently demand absolute loyalty. Dissenters become traitors. Hatred follows as a supposed duty.

Modern social media accelerates this. Algorithms reward outrage and division. A post criticizing a policy can quickly become a campaign of patriots hatred against a demographic. People share anger more eagerly than nuance.

The data speaks volumes. Studies from the Pew Research Center show rising hostility tied to nationalist rhetoric. Pew Research Center - National Identity & Polarization

Breaking the Cycle of Aggression

Repairing this damage requires deliberate action. Individuals must separate policy disagreement from personal hatred. Communities need spaces where dissent is safe.

Education plays a key role. Teaching critical thinking helps citizens challenge toxic narratives. Recognizing patriots hatred in ourselves is the first step. We all carry biases we rarely examine.

Civic engagement should focus on building bridges. Volunteer work, honest dialogue, and local activism foster genuine unity. These actions reject the easy comfort of hatred. True love for a nation demands constant, difficult work.
